The Accessibility Partners & InclUSion Podcast
The Accessibility Partners and InclUSion podcast is hosted by Mandy-Jayne Lace. The podcast explores a wealth of topics, deep-diving into life with a disability, be it physical, a learning disability, or neurodiversity. Our challenges are unique, and this podcast aims to inspire conversations about how we all have a role to play in fostering better inclusion and reframing those stereotypical preconceptions around disability.
Accessibility Partners - The business she owns. Accessibility Partners exists to help the disabled community navigate the Access to Work process, enabling people to access the support they need to thrive in the workplace, whether through self-employment or with an organisation.
M-J's non profit, InclUSion is on a mission to make society accessible and equitable for everyone, irrespective of the challenges we face.

Episode Twenty Five: Constructing Change in Mental Health, with Luke Coggon
In this episode of the Accessibility Partners and InclUSion podcast, M-J is joined by founder of Thinking Differently Ltd, Luke Coggon. Luke has a wealth of experience in the construction industry and was inspired to establish his company and other ventures to challenge the stigma attached to mental health and the lack of representation and understanding of disability within that environment.
M-J and Luke explore his journey as a founder thus far, his hopes for his business, and unpack why breaking those stereotypes around mental health, especially in a male-dominated industry like construction, matters as much now as it ever did.
